Mining, yeah, that is an issue, but we can solve that.

Before any mine is permitted to open, there should be the requirement to establish an independent environmental fund, the fund will be started with a lump sum, and every year X% of the value of the minerals extracted that year will be put into the environmental fund.

That fund is then used to clean up the site and restore it as much as possible.

Transportation? Most countries (including the US) have working freight rail system, cheap and one of the most environmentally friendly ways of overland transport.

Reactors not blowing up? That is an extremely uncommon failure mode. It is mostly solved by planning, don't build in seismic active areas, select the correct type of reactor, establish safe procedures and have a disciplined and well trained workforce.
